WebThings Gateway

Host your own private smart home


WebThings Gateway is a software distribution for smart home hubs focused on privacy, security and interoperability.

A screenshot of a grid of icons representing devices in a smart home

Unified Web Interface

Monitor and control all your smart home devices via a unified web interface.

A screenshot of a drag and drop interface with inputs and outputs

Rules Engine

Create "if this then that" style rules to automate your home with a simple drag and drop interface.

A screenshot with icons representing devices on a floorplan of a house


Lay out all your devices on an interactive floorplan of your home for at-a-glance status and control.

A screenshot of interactive graphs of sensor data over time


Log sensor data over time to identify trends, spot anomalies and make optimisations.

A screenshot of a directory of installable add-ons


Add compatibility with more devices and protocols with adapter add-ons.


WebThings Gateway

for Raspberry Pi

Raspberry Pi Download 1.1
Documentation »

WebThings Gateway

for Docker

Docker Download 1.1
Documentation »

Built on W3C Web of Things standards.

Block diagram showing the Web of Things as an abstraction layer on top of other IoT technologies like Zigbee, Z-Wave and HomeKit